Lithologic Log
(Log data entered from KOLAR.)
From: 0 ft. to 4 ft. top soil
From: 4 ft. to 22 ft. clay, brown
From: 22 ft. to 28 ft. fine to coarse sand
From: 28 ft. to 68 ft. clay, brown
From: 68 ft. to 72 ft. fine sand with caliche stringers
From: 72 ft. to 85 ft. clay with caliche stringers, brown, weakly cemented
From: 85 ft. to 104 ft. clayey fine to medium sand
From: 104 ft. to 129 ft. fine to coarse sand
From: 129 ft. to 143 ft. sandy clay
From: 143 ft. to 150 ft. medium to coarse sand and gravel
From: 150 ft. to 153 ft. caliche
From: 153 ft. to 158 ft. shale, slightly weathered, black
